Compute gene level effective lengths

import argparse | |
import pandas as pd | |
import numpy as np | |
import sys | |
def main(args): | |
gtable = pd.read_table(args.ginput).set_index('Name') | |
ttable = pd.read_table(args.tinput).set_index('Name') | |
tgmap = pd.read_table(args.tgmap, names=['t', 'g']).set_index('t') | |
gene_lengths = {} | |
j = 0 | |
# Map over all gene groups (a gene and its associated transcripts) | |
for g, txps in tgmap.groupby('g').groups.iteritems(): | |
if j % 500 == 1: | |
print("Processed {} genes".format(j)) | |
j += 1 | |
# The set of transcripts present in our salmon index | |
tset = [] | |
for t in txps: | |
if t in ttable.index: | |
tset.append(t) | |
# If at least one of the transcripts was present | |
if len(tset) > 0: | |
# The denominator is the sum of all TPMs | |
totlen = ttable.loc[tset,'TPM'].sum() | |
# Turn the relative TPMs into a proper partition of unity | |
if totlen > 0: | |
tpm_fracs = ttable.loc[tset, 'TPM'].values / ttable.loc[tset,'TPM'].sum() | |
else: | |
tpm_fracs = np.ones(len(tset)) / float(len(tset)) | |
# Compute the gene's effective length as the abundance-weight | |
# sum of the transcript lengths | |
elen = 0.0 | |
for i,t in enumerate(tset): | |
elen += tpm_fracs[i] * ttable.loc[t, 'EffectiveLength'] | |
gene_lengths[g] = elen | |
# Give the table an effective length field | |
gtable['EffectiveLength'] = gtable.apply(lambda r : gene_lengths[r.name] if r.name in gene_lengths else 1.0, axis=1) | |
# Write it to the output file | |
gtable.to_csv(args.output, sep='\t', index_label='Name') | |
if __name__ == "__main__": | |
parser = argparse.ArgumentParser(description="Compute gene-level effective lengths") | |
parser.add_argument('--ginput', type=str, help='gene level input table') | |
parser.add_argument('--tinput', type=str, help='transcript level input table') | |
parser.add_argument('--tgmap', type=str, help='transcript -> gene mapping') | |
parser.add_argument('--output', type=str, help='output table with extra column') | |
args = parser.parse_args() | |
main(args) |
